Model: Archer BE800   Archer BE550  
Hardware Version: V2
Firmware Version: Latest

Hi everyone,

 

I try to make a wireless connection in bridge mode between the Archer BE800 (main router) and Archer BE550.

I want to use the BE550 just to connect devices by cables Lan, I don't want it to amplify wifi like in EasyMesh mode.

I try to find in settings the way to do that but I can't find the solution to do this.

Can you help me?

What is the procedure and steps to do to have bridge mode?

 

Specifically I would like the two routers to be connected on 6Ghz (not being very far apart).

 

Thank you for your help!

The Archer BE550 (and also the BE800) does not have the type of wireless bridge mode that you are looking for.

 

EasyMesh is the only operation mode that allows the two routers to be interconnected wirelessly.
